Key Responsibilities

As a Customer & Commercial Leadership Intern, you will be exposed to Coca-Cola's commercial and customer-focused strategies. You will help manage customer relationships, optimize sales operations, and ensure Coca-Cola's products are available and accessible to consumers.

  • Assist in managing key customer accounts and relationships.
  • Support the execution of promotional and sales strategies.
  • Analyze sales performance data to identify growth opportunities and drive results.
  • Collaborate with marketing and supply chain teams to ensure seamless execution.
  • Help implement sales training and development programs for field teams.
  • Support customer negotiations and contribute to business growth.

Requirements

  • Educational background: An undergraduate student, pursuing a bachelor's degree, or master's student, completing a master's degree in Business, Sales, Marketing, or related field.
  • Right to work: Legal authorisation to work in the UK. No visa sponsorship is provided.
  • Commitment: Must be available to start October 1st 2025 and commit to 36.25 hours/week for a 9-12 month internship.
  • Language: Fluency in English (with strong verbal and written communication skills)
  • Attributes: Enthusiasm towards Coca-Cola, its brands and its values. Curious, agile, creative and passionate about learning and making a true impact in a high-performance and diverse environment.
  • Relationship skills: Being inclusive, team-oriented, and adept at building relationships.
  • Relevant Knowledge: Basic understanding of commercial and strategies as well as market trends. Strategic and critical thinking with a customer centric approach. Good negotiation and persuasion skills. Analytical skills to understand market trends.
